There may be successive bond issues for the purpose of financing the same industrial facilities, involving one (1) or more industries, and there may be successive bond issues for financing the cost of reconstructing, replacing, constructing additions to, extending, improving, and equipping industrial facilities already in existence, whether or not originally financed by bonds issued under this subchapter, with each successive issue to be authorized as provided by this subchapter. Acts 1985, No. 1017, § 5; A.S.A. 1947, § 13-1277.
